Fuel Stabilizer How To Use. Fuel stabilizers are additives that extend a gasoline’s lifespan by preventing water, and fuel evaporation, and the “rottening” of gasoline with age (think lawn mowers). You can use fuel stabilizer on anything that has an engine. In addition to storing cars, you can also use it to help protect lawn mowers, snowmobiles, or even. Utilizing a combination of lubricating and antioxidizing agents, the fuel stabilizer prevents the gasoline in the tank from evaporating or going stale,.
